What Is Off-Road? Understanding the Terrain and Beyond
Off-road refers to driving or riding on natural or undeveloped surfaces not designed for motorized vehicles—such as mud, sand, rocks, dunes, and steep inclines. Unlike on-road conditions, off-rolling environments demand specialized vehicles capable of handling mechanical shocks, steep grades, and unpredictable surfaces. Off-roading blends technical skill with physical challenge, offering a unique escape from paved roads into nature’s wildest corners.

Essential Gear: $ for Safety, Comfort, and Performance
Beyond your vehicle, essential off-road gear includes:
- Protective clothing: Shock-absorbing boots, long pants, gloves
- Navigation tools: GPS device, trail maps, offline maps on smartphone
- Communication devices: Satellite communicators or two-way radios
- Repair kit: Jumper cables, spare tires, jack, basic toolkit
- Comfort essentials: Cooler, water supply, high-energy snacks
Each item contributes to safer, longer, and more enjoyable excursions—making gear a vital dollar investment in your off-road success.
